Reach Of Of Online Radio vs Podcasts, 2000-2016 [CHART]57% of Americans aged 12 and older this year report listening to online radio on a monthly basis, and 88% of those listeners (50% of respondents overall) listen on a weekly basis, per the latest edition of the annual Infinite Dial report. Both monthly and weekly online radio listening have grown across age groups, with weekly reach up by a third among the 55+ group (24%, from 18%).

Meanwhile, 36% of respondents this year report having ever listened to a podcast, with 21% doing so a monthly basis (up from 17% last year) and 13% on a weekly basis (up from 10% last year). The report shows a sizable jump in monthly podcast listening among the 25-54 demographic (24% this year, up from 19% last year), and also notes that men (24%) are considerably more likely than women (18%) to have listened to a podcast in the last month.
